Key Facts

  • Robo.ai to acquire Neurovia AI for $100 million in stock.
  • Acquisition supports Robo.ai's transition to physical AI infrastructure.
  • Neurovia specializes in data processing, key for AI applications.
  • Robo.ai plans to enhance video data infrastructure post-acquisition.
  • Equity lock-up established for eight years to ensure stability.
